smarTours Resumes International Tours Starting in May
smarTours announced the company’s international tours will resume starting in May, thanks to improving travel restrictions and vaccination efforts after a year-plus hiatus due to the Covid-19 pandemic.
The first two tours will travel to Costa Rica (May 10th departure) and Egypt (June 21st departure) with additional tours including Alaska, Greece, South Africa, Kenya, UAE, and Peru planned throughout the summer.
In addition, tours to Kenya, Turkey, Jordan, Kenya, Iceland, Israel, and France are coming soon.
“One lesson from the pandemic is to take advantage of the time you have and see the places you want to see,” says Christine Petersen, CEO of smarTours. “Travelers are ready to check off bucket list destinations and experiences."
All smarTours will include comprehensive Covid safety precautions including individual safety packs, advanced emergency action plan, a list of health services and institutions in each destination, daily disinfecting of the bus, avoiding overcrowded destinations, contactless check-ins, alternatives to buffet meals, and social distancing practices throughout the tour. In addition, the company will coordinate group testing before returning to the U.S.
